Sažetak

The paper analyzes painting The Bride of Pivljanin Bajo as an example of the nationally engaged work of Đura Jakšić and verbal-visual permeation. The painting and its function are interpreted in the context of the political reality at the time - the national struggle for liberation from Ottoman rule, pointing to the influences and iconographic templates of contemporary European historical painting, primarily the painting of Eugène Delacroix.
